What are the most common Jeep repairs needed by drivers in the Glenshaw area?

Given our hilly terrain and winter road salt, common repairs include addressing rust on frames and body panels, 4x4 system servicing for the seasonal changes, and suspension work from navigating rougher local roads. Wranglers and Cherokees also frequently need attention for steering components and oil leaks from older engines.

When should I seek service for my Jeep's 4x4 system in Pennsylvania?

It's wise to have your 4WD system inspected and serviced in the early fall, before the Pittsburgh-area winter hits. If you hear unusual noises from the transfer case, experience difficulty engaging 4WD, or notice warning lights, seek service immediately to ensure it's ready for Glenshaw's snowy and icy hills.

Are repair costs for Jeeps generally higher at local dealerships versus independent shops in Glenshaw?

Typically, yes, dealership labor rates are higher. Many independent shops in the Glenshaw/Shaler area can perform the same quality work, often with more personalized service, at a lower cost. Always get a detailed written estimate that breaks down parts and labor, regardless of where you go.

What local factors should I consider when maintaining my Jeep in Glenshaw?

The heavy use of road salt in winter makes frequent undercarriage washes crucial to prevent severe rust. Also, consider the wear from constant stop-and-go traffic on Route 8 on components like brakes and transmissions. Using a shop familiar with these local conditions ensures they know what to inspect for proactively.
